According to reports from a
research conducted by Claude steele, it is observed that test performance can
be depressed by a self-fulfilling phenomenon, which is called the stereotype
threat. Stereotype threat is an occurrence in where people are inhibited by
doubts on their ability due to the stereotypes about their social group.
